On Wed, Mar 10, 2021 at 12:41:18PM -0800, Ian Rogers wrote: > Retry the ping loop upto 600 times, or approximately 30 seconds, to make > sure the test does hang at start up. > > Signed-off-by: Ian Rogers <irogers@google.com> > --- > tools/perf/tests/shell/daemon.sh | 7 +++++++ > 1 file changed, 7 insertions(+) > > diff --git a/tools/perf/tests/shell/daemon.sh b/tools/perf/tests/shell/daemon.sh > index a02cedc76de6..cb831ff2c185 100755 > --- a/tools/perf/tests/shell/daemon.sh > +++ b/tools/perf/tests/shell/daemon.sh > @@ -127,9 +127,16 @@ daemon_start() > > # wait for the session to ping > local state="FAIL" > + local retries=0 > while [ "${state}" != "OK" ]; do > state=`perf daemon ping --config ${config} --session ${session} | awk '{ print $1 }'` > sleep 0.05 > + retries=$((${retries} +1)) > + if [ ${retries} -ge 600 ]; then > + echo "Timeout waiting for daemon to ping" > + daemon_exit ${config} > + exit 62 > + fi
so it broke in here for you? ;-) makes sense, please keep the 'FAILED: ...' prefix so it's obvious it's an error
